logo

Output 45de66d52397817eecd7ebfba8ae9d9e6e3e59068a735d42b39e72d98ea20386:0

value
930000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 126522221d3040873839dd7e5a033022b5af5095 OP_EQUAL
address
33NHEs4K66DEUyfqPPW65xLyUj5LTRCnpA
transaction
45de66d52397817eecd7ebfba8ae9d9e6e3e59068a735d42b39e72d98ea20386